CH. Karnchang Public Company Limited (CK) hereby informs the
resolutions of the Board of Directors' Meeting No. 2/2010 which was held on
March 25, 2010 as follows:
1. Approval was granted for the Company to establish a subsidiary
for the purpose of the electricity production concession granted by the Lao
People's Democratic Republic, named Xayaburi Power Company Limited (XPCL),
which would be registered as legal entity under the law of the Lao People's
Democratic Republic, with an initial registered capital of Baht 800 Million,
in which 100 percent of shares will be held by the Company with the initial
share payment at 30 percent.
In this regard, the Executive Board has been authorized to consider
approaching strategic investors in Xayaburi Power Company Limited in the
future. The Company shall comply with the applicable rules of the
Office of the Securities and Exchange Commission and/or the Stock Exchange of
Thailand.
Remark: CK signed the Project Development Agreement ("PDA") with the
Government of the Lao People's Democratic Republic in 2008 to conduct the
feasibility study of the construction of the Mekong Mainstream Run-of-River
Hydropower in Xayaburi Province (Xayaburi Hydroelectric Power Project). Based
on the initial study, the Xayaburi Hydroelectric Power Project would have the
electricity production capacity up to 1,280 MW, and, upon completion of the
construction, would be able to generate approximately 7,370 GWh/year of
electricity for sale to the Electricity Generating Authority of Thailand
(EGAT); the catchment area of the Xayaburi dam covers approximately 280,000
square kilometers. In this regard, it is expected that such project would have
the total construction value of more than US$ 2,000 Million, whereby the
Company would appoint CH. Karnchang (Lao) Co., Ltd. as main construction
contractor, and the Company expects that the construction would be completed
and electricity would be generated for sale to EGAT in and around 2019.
At present, the feasibility study of such project has been already completed,
and the National Energy Policy Council's meeting has granted approval for
signing the memorandum of agreement for power purchase from the Xayaburi
Hydroelectric Power Project, the Lao People's Democratic Republic, for sale to
Thailand, in the amount of 1,220 MW, at the price of Baht 2.159 per unit.
2. Approval was granted for the Company and/or Xayaburi Power
Company Limited (XPCL) to sign the Memorandum of Understanding (MOU) with the
Electricity Generating Authority of Thailand (EGAT). The levelized tariff in
the MOU would be set at Baht 2.159/unit (GWh). Such MOU shall be valid
for 18 months from the signing date or until the Power Purchase Agreement
would be signed, whichever occurs first.
